Output c5e816401f2bc62f301bfb62319ff32f99ece69709af32560cb428e94249f7e6:39

value
250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1bd064a0f94776d3e84c7a89a3a0ce5341dfcc1 OP_EQUALVERIFY OP_CHECKSIG
address
1MabUpWH9f4oqBkYnLemLuXDLdKMm6N7Y8
transaction
c5e816401f2bc62f301bfb62319ff32f99ece69709af32560cb428e94249f7e6
confirmations
426870
spent
true